Who Is Jorge Mario Bergoglio?
Before we delve into the topic of Jorge Mario Bergoglio wife, let’s take a moment to understand who Jorge Mario Bergoglio is. Born on December 17, 1936, in Buenos Aires, Argentina, Jorge Mario Bergoglio is the first pope from the Americas and the first Jesuit pope. His journey to becoming Pope Francis is filled with humility, dedication, and a commitment to serving others.
Known for his simplicity and compassion, Pope Francis has made significant changes in the Catholic Church. He advocates for social justice, environmental conservation, and inclusivity. His leadership style is a departure from the traditional pomp and circumstance often associated with the papacy.

Common Misconceptions About Priests and Marriage
One of the most common misconceptions is that priests can secretly marry and have families. While there are exceptions in some Eastern Catholic Churches, the Latin Rite, to which Pope Francis belongs, strictly enforces the rule of celibacy. Priests who marry are typically laicized, meaning they are no longer allowed to function as priests.
Another misconception is that celibacy is a recent development in the Catholic Church. In reality, the practice dates back centuries and has been an integral part of the Church’s tradition. Understanding these facts helps dispel the myths surrounding Jorge Mario Bergoglio wife.

Historical Context of Celibacy
To understand why there’s no Jorge Mario Bergoglio wife, it’s essential to explore the historical context of celibacy in the Catholic Church. The practice dates back to the early days of Christianity, with roots in the teachings of Jesus Christ and the apostles.
Celibacy became a formal requirement for priests in the 12th century, solidifying its place in Church doctrine. Over the centuries, it has evolved but remains a core aspect of the Catholic faith. The reasons for celibacy are deeply theological, emphasizing the priest’s role as a mediator between God and humanity.
